Hello dear ClickBank affiliates. I bring you good news. ClickBank is now offering their own text ads system called “HopAds”. The system is very similar to AdSense ads except the ads aren’t contextualized and of course they’ll display ClickBank products. I think this product is long overdue. I have been using something similar to this for a long long time but none of the existing systems that I’ve tried have been perfect. My main gripe has been the poor description. What’s cool about ClickBank’s HopAds system is that ad descriptions will be provided by the product vendor themselves, so it will be far more relevant and useful as compared to existing systems which take the first few words of the clickbank product’s promo page. Here is a copy of ClickBank’s news release:
“2009-02-11
ClickBank is excited to announce the ClickBank HopAds Builder, a powerful new way for affiliates to promote ClickBank products. The HopAds Builder allows affiliates who own Web sites or blogs to easily create fully customizable ad boxes. This tool allows affiliates to customize both the look and content of ads to match their site.
The HopAds Builder is entirely free to use, and HopAds pay out the same affiliate commissions as Hoplinks created through the Marketplace. HopAds use ad text created by ClickBank publishers to appeal directly to consumers, and all ads are screened by ClickBank for content and quality.”
